Credit Hours: 200 Study of the assessment of the critical respiratory patient Includes cardiac output assessment, invasive hemodynamic monitoring, assessment of sleep-related breathing disorders, nutritional assessment and the respiratory system, advanced cardiac arrhythmia interpretation, and bronchoscopy Prerequisite(s): RTH 135, 162 Course Corequisites: RTH 241, RTH 241LB, RTH 243LB, RTH 245LC Information: This course is only open to those students who have been admitted to the RTH program Offered: Fall
